您好,歡迎來電子發(fā)燒友網(wǎng)! ,新用戶?[免費注冊]

您的位置:電子發(fā)燒友網(wǎng)>源碼下載>C/C++語言編程>

淺談輸入法編程

大?。?/span>41 人氣: 2010-10-16 需要積分:0
YYXIAO的空間

用戶級別:注冊會員

貢獻(xiàn)文章:

貢獻(xiàn)資料:

首先我們需要明白輸入法是什么東西。目前常用的輸入法基本上有兩種類型:外掛式(如早期的萬能五筆)及輸入法接口式(Input Method Editor-IME)。外掛式比較簡單,就是一個exe文件,通過模擬一些Windows輸入消息來給當(dāng)前處于活動狀態(tài)的編輯窗口輸入文字,一個顯著的優(yōu)點是輸入法只要啟動一次,就可以在所有進程中使用;但缺點不不容忽視,首先實現(xiàn)起來也不容易,一個更大的不足是兼容性不夠好,通常一個Windows版本需要一人對應(yīng)的輸入法版本,此外這類輸入法為了能夠截獲用戶輸入,通常需要掛接鍵盤鉤子,容易造成系統(tǒng)不穩(wěn)定或者效率不高。大部分的輸入法還是采用IME來實現(xiàn),下面本文主要討論一下IME編程需要注意的問題及解決辦法。


?

非常好我支持^.^

(7) 100%

不好我反對

(0) 0%

      發(fā)表評論

      用戶評論
      評價:好評中評差評

      發(fā)表評論,獲取積分! 請遵守相關(guān)規(guī)定!

      ?